Position Summary

The Electrical Foreman oversees field electrical employees (Licensed & Apprentices), ensuring that all work meets safety standards, project specifications, and company quality expectations.  This position is responsible for coordinating and supervising electricians and apprentices on-site, maintaining project schedules, and ensuring materials and manpower are effectively managed so the project is successful. 


Key Responsibilities

  • Supervise and lead crews of electricians and apprentices on commercial, industrial, or residential projects.
  • Plan, layout, and coordinate electrical installations based on blueprints, drawings, and specifications, and profecting with Blue Beam
  • Ensure compliance with the National Electrical Code (NEC), local regulations, and company safety policies.
  • Communicate effectively with project managers, general contractors, and inspectors to coordinate work.
  • Schedule and assign tasks to ensure project deadlines and milestones are met.
  • Perform quality checks and inspections to verify that installations meet required standards.
  • Ensures Company Safety Standards are adhered to on-the-job sites.
  • Order, track, and manage tools, materials, daily jobsite pictures, and equipment for assigned jobs.
  • Mentor apprentices and junior electricians to promote skill development and adherence to best practices.
  • Maintain accurate daily job reports, time logs, and material usage documentation.
  • Identify and resolve on-site issues quickly to minimize project delays.
  • Follows company policies and procedures, ensures assigned employees comply as well.
  • Meet company’s core values and GWC


Qualifications

  • High school diploma or equivalent; Minimum 5–8 years of electrical experience, including at least 2 years in a supervisory or foreman role.
  • Valid journeyman or master electrician license.  Must be licensed in both Massachusetts and Rhode Island
  • Minimum 5–8 years of electrical experience, including at least 2 years in a supervisory or foreman role.
  • Strong understanding of NEC codes, electrical theory, and construction processes.
  • Ability to read and interpret blueprints, schematics, and wiring diagrams.
  • Proficient in using hand tools, testing equipment, and electrical construction tools.
  • Excellent communication, organizational, and leadership skills.
  • OSHA-10 required, OSHA 30-hour certification preferred to start and need to be completed in the first year.
  • Valid driver’s license with a clean driving record.


Working Conditions

  • Work performed primarily on active construction sites.
  • Exposure to varying weather conditions, heights, confined spaces, and electrical hazards.
  • May require extended hours, including nights or weekends, depending on project demands.
